As the countdown to the new school year begins, Sheehy Auto Stores is proud to once again rally behind our local students, teachers, and schools with our Annual School Supply Drive, running from Monday, July 28 to Monday, August 11.
At 30 Sheehy dealerships across Virginia, Maryland, and Washington, D.C., we’re collecting brand-new school supplies to help ensure every child in our community starts the year confident and prepared.

What We’re Collecting:
We’re welcoming donations of new, unused supplies including:
- Backpacks
- Paper (lined, copy, construction, notebooks)
- Writing tools (#2 pencils, pens, crayons, markers, highlighters)
- Classroom essentials (folders, glue sticks, rulers, calculators)
- Hygiene items (tissues, hand sanitizer, disinfecting wipes)
